What service do you need
Location
Use My Location
Log In
Sign Up
Find Pros
Log In
Sign Up
Home
IL
Worden
Gutters & Downspouts
Ecoflow Gutter Solutions
Gallery
Ecoflow Gutter Solutions
8140 Possum Hill Rd, Worden, IL 62097
Gutters & Downspouts
Gallery
(1)